Notes
Source(s): Rigler-Deutsch Index; Victor ledgers; disc.
An earlier recording by Harry Macdonough (see B-4158) also was issued as 16060.
Victor ledgers, 8/28/1922: "Extra man—Jos. Freides—piano."
